EA Announces Real Racing 3 Will Launch for Free on Feb. 28th

Real racing 3

EA has announced Real Racing 3 will be released worldwide on February 28th and will be based on a freemium model with in-app purchases:

Today we announced Real Racing 3 will be free. And yes, Real Racing 3 was designed from the ground up to be a free to play experience. We are so excited about this game and wanted it to be accessible to everyone so we didn’t want there to be any barriers to entry. This accessibility is also what drives the awesome new Time Shifted Multiplayer feature, in that you can play competitive multiplayer with anyone any time, and they don’t need to be online with you at the same time. At launch we have 46 licensed vehicles covering 3 classes, a 22 car grid, real world tracks, 8 varied event types and 900+ events. This means hundreds of hours of gameplay for free making this one of the most expansive games ever on mobile. We plan to continue to add more free and exciting content with every update.

Currently, Real Racing 2 is priced at $4.99 but this marks the emergence of the freemium model being adopted by numerous high profile games, such as Temple Run 2. Imangi Studios, creators of Temple Run 2 previously stated in an interview “in-app purchases way exceeded what we would have made from the paid game.”

Real Racing 3 will have 46 licensed cars, real world tracks and over 900+ events. You can expect in-app purchases will be popular with car enthusiasts that want to immediately drive their favourite car.
